How To Fix ‘Unidentified Network’ Issue With Ethernet?
When your Ethernet connection suddenly displays an “Unidentified Network” status, it typically means that your computer has connected to a network but cannot access the internet. This issue often occurs due to incorrect IP configurations, most commonly when the network adapter fails to obtain a valid IP address from the DHCP server.
